How to fix?

Upgrade SLES:15.6 gfs2-kmp-default to version 6.4.0-150600.23.84.1 or higher.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

pinctrl: at91-pio4: check return value of devm_kasprintf()

devm_kasprintf() returns a pointer to dynamically allocated memory. Pointer could be NULL in case allocation fails. Check pointer validity. Identified with coccinelle (kmerr.cocci script).

Depends-on: 1c4e5c470a56 ("pinctrl: at91: use devm_kasprintf() to avoid potential leaks") Depends-on: 5a8f9cf269e8 ("pinctrl: at91-pio4: use proper format specifier for unsigned int")
